The endocrine system, a sophisticated network of glands, orchestrates a symphony of chemical messengers that govern nearly every physiological process, including cognition. Testosterone, for instance, a steroid hormone found in both sexes, plays a crucial role beyond muscle mass and libido. Its optimal levels correlate with improved spatial memory, executive function, and overall cognitive processing speed. Declines in this hormone can correlate with a noticeable drop in mental energy and clarity.
Estrogen, similarly significant in both male and female physiology, profoundly influences neuroprotection, synaptic plasticity, and cerebral blood flow. Maintaining adequate estrogen levels supports memory retention and reduces the risk of certain cognitive performance blockers. This chemical messenger acts as a key architect for brain tissue integrity and function.
Growth hormone (GH) and its downstream mediator, Insulin-like Growth Factor 1 (IGF-1), also wield substantial influence over brain health. These peptides contribute to neuronal maintenance, neurogenesis, and synaptic connections. A reduction in their activity can impact cognitive speed and mood regulation.

When testosterone levels decline in men, often accompanying aging, many experience a notable reduction in mental sharpness and motivation. Strategic TRT, guided by comprehensive diagnostic assessments, restores these levels to an optimal range. This restoration frequently results in improved concentration, enhanced verbal fluency, and a renewed sense of mental drive.
For women navigating perimenopause and menopause, fluctuations and declines in estrogen and progesterone often correlate with significant cognitive disruptions. Brain fog, memory lapses, and difficulties with focus become common complaints. Precisely tailored bioidentical hormone therapy can stabilize these levels, supporting neuronal health and mitigating these performance blockers.
